Now Hiring: Quality Inspector – Aerospace Manufacturing

Are you an experienced Quality Inspector looking to advance your career in a high-precision aerospace machine shop? We are seeking mid- to advanced-level Inspectors with strong experience inspecting machined metal aerospace or military parts, proficiency in GD&T, hands-on surface plate inspection experience, and familiarity with AS9100, AS9102, and ANSI Y14.5 standards.

This is a hands-on inspection role—not a quality administrator position—and does not involve final-release, audit packages, or administrative QA paperwork

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form in-process and first-article (AS9102) inspections of precision-machined aerospace components.
  • Perform dimensional inspections using surface plates and precision inspection equipment.
  • Use precision tools such as micrometers, calipers, thread gauges, height gauges, CMMs, profilometers, and optical comparators.
  • Interpret complex blueprints and technical drawings using advanced GD&T (ANSI Y14.5).
  • Record inspection results in MRP systems.
  • Support NCR investigations and basic root-cause discussions (no ownership of CAPA or audit documentation).
  • Mentor junior inspectors and support team development.
  • Assist with traceability checks and adherence to FOD, PPE, and cleanroom protocols.
  • Ensure compliance with AS9100, ITAR, and internal quality procedures.

Skills/Abilities

  • Minimum 3 years inspecting machined aerospace or military parts (metal only).
  • Hands-on experience performing dimensional inspections on a surface plate.
  • Strong proficiency in GD&T, dimensional inspection, and visual inspection.
  • Knowledge of AS9100, AS9102, and ANSI Y14.5.
  • CMM programming experience (PC-DMIS) strongly preferred; ability to create or modify CMM routines is a plus.
  • Experience with 1factory, FileMaker, or similar QMS/MRP systems.
  • Strong shop math, problem-solving, and English communication skills.
  • Dependable, quality-focused, and able to work independently or in a team.
  • Must pass annual visual acuity and color-perception tests (NDT standards).
  • U.S. person required for ITAR compliance.

ITAR Requirement

This position requires the use of information subject to the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R). The candidate must be a U.S. person within the meaning of ITAR. ITAR defines U.S. persons as U.S. citizens, lawful permanent residents (i.e., Green Card holders), and some refugees.
